More likely the tank is waterlogged. Should be an air valve at the top. Depress the stem for a few seconds. If water comes out, then the tank is bad.

I would agree that watching the gauge is useful. If the tank is waterlogged, then you will notice the pressure swinging rapidly up and down every few seconds.

Might add that the tank is not engaging. It is the pump that is turning off/on.
